Culex pipiens eggs are laid in what arrangement on water?

Explanation:
Culex pipiens lays its eggs in a floating raft on the water surface. A female deposits a single mass of eggs that stick together into a gelatinous raft, often containing hundreds of eggs, which sits on the water until hatching. This arrangement ensures many eggs are laid quickly and positioned right at the water’s surface where they will hatch when conditions are wet. The other patterns—eggs laid singly, on vegetation, or buried in mud—do not match how Culex pipiens reproduces.
